"My Way" (feat. Monty) is the third single from Fetty Wap's 2015 self-titled debut album. Released commercially on July 17, 2015, following a massive viral surge on SoundCloud, the track solidified Fetty Wap as a dominant force in hip-hop during the mid-2010s.
Monty (born Angel Cosme) is a longtime friend of Fetty Wap and a frequent collaborator within the Remy Boyz collective. While Monty appears on several of the album's hits, including "679," "My Way" is often cited as a track Fetty specifically used to help launch Monty’s career. : The song was a massive hit, peaking at number 7 on the US Billboard Hot 100. Its rapid ascent—jumping 80 spots in a single week—made Fetty Wap the first male rapper to have two concurrent top-ten hits as a lead artist since Lil Wayne in 2011.
